How is Taster's Choice different from regular ground coffee?
Asked 4 months ago
Taster's Choice primarily offers instant coffee, which distinguishes it from regular ground coffee in a few key ways. Instant coffee is made from brewed coffee that has been dehydrated into a powder or granules, allowing consumers to prepare a cup of coffee simply by adding hot water. This process results in a product that is quick and easy to prepare, making it convenient for those with busy lifestyles or for those who do not have access to brewing equipment.
In contrast, regular ground coffee requires brewing methods such as using a coffee maker, French press, or pour-over technique. This process often takes more time and can be more involved, as it requires appropriate brewing equipment and attention to the brewing time and temperature.
Moreover, Taster's Choice aims to provide a flavor profile that appeals to those who enjoy instant coffee, striving for a taste that mirrors freshly brewed coffee. Users may also find that Taster's Choice products offer various flavors and blends, allowing for a customizable coffee experience.
